The 2006 FIFA World Cup qualification UEFA Group 8 was a UEFA qualifying group for the 2006 FIFA World Cup. The group comprised Bulgaria, Croatia, Hungary, Iceland, Malta and Sweden.
The group was won by Croatia, who qualified for the 2006 FIFA World Cup. The runners-up Sweden also qualified as one of two best runners-up.
